Product Description
The 320 gallon Peabody Gemini Dual Containment Cylindrical Tank is a tank inside a tank: if the primary wall ever fails, the chemical stays in the secondary shell instead of on your floor. Both walls are molded polyethylene, so the assembly shrugs off the acids, caustics and hypochlorite that attack stainless steel.
Measuring 48" diameter x 60.5" high, this Gemini Dual Containment Cylindrical Tank holds 320 gallons.

FEATURES
- Tank-in-a-tank dual wall construction meets EPA 40 CFR secondary containment
- Secondary tank leak detection port for an optional leak alarm
- Integral pump mounting platform on the dome, rated for pumps up to 240 lb
- Pump pick-up tube port seals the contents from the outside air once installed
- Recessed mouse door on most models for an optional dual wall bulkhead fitting
- LPE tanks are NSF/ANSI/CAN 61 certified; XLPE is certified from 40 gallons up
MATERIAL SELECTION GUIDANCE
Linear polyethylene (LPE) is typically selected for general chemical and water storage; cross-linked polyethylene (XLPE) where greater impact and stress-crack resistance is preferred; polypropylene (PPL) and polyvinylidene fluoride (PVDF) for resin-specific chemistries. Choose based on chemical compatibility first: suitability depends on your specific chemical, its concentration and its temperature, and is the buyer's responsibility to verify before ordering. The specific gravity rating states the heaviest liquid the wall is designed to hold — a 1.5 wall up to about 12.5 lb per gallon, a 1.9 wall up to about 16 lb per gallon.
These are vented, atmospheric storage tanks. Not for pressurized or vacuum service.

WARRANTY TERMS
Peabody Engineering warrants this product against defects in material and workmanship for 36 months from the date of shipment, when it is installed, used and maintained as intended. Chemical compatibility, service temperature and liquid specific gravity are the buyer's responsibility: damage from an incompatible chemical, from service above the rated temperature, or from a liquid heavier than the wall rating is not covered.
